Why Proper Airflow Is Essential for Dryer Performance
A dryer depends on unrestricted airflow to operate efficiently. During each drying cycle, the appliance generates warm air that absorbs moisture from clothing. This moisture-laden air must then travel through the vent system and exit the home.
When airflow remains strong and unrestricted, clothes dry efficiently, and the dryer performs as intended. However, even small airflow restrictions can reduce performance over time. As airflow decreases, moisture removal becomes less effective, forcing the dryer to work longer to achieve the same results.
Many Tampa homeowners first notice airflow problems when drying cycles begin taking longer than usual. Because these changes often occur gradually, they are easy to overlook. Over time, however, reduced airflow may lead to increasing frustration and declining dryer efficiency.
The vent system plays a direct role in maintaining consistent dryer performance. If airflow becomes restricted anywhere within the vent pathway, the entire drying process can be affected. Maintaining proper airflow helps support shorter drying times, more consistent results, and improved appliance operation.

Lint Buildup Is One of the Most Common Performance Problems
Lint accumulation is one of the leading causes of dryer vent performance issues. Although lint screens capture much of the material generated during drying cycles, smaller particles continue entering the vent system with every load.
Over time, lint may accumulate inside the vent and gradually restrict airflow.
Common warning signs of lint-related airflow problems include:
- Longer drying times
- Clothes remaining damp after one cycle
- Excessive heat around the dryer
- Reduced airflow from the exterior vent
- Increased energy consumption
- More frequent dryer operation
- Hot laundry room conditions
Many homeowners are surprised by how much lint can accumulate inside a vent system despite regular lint trap cleaning. Because buildup develops gradually, airflow restrictions often go unnoticed until dryer performance begins declining significantly.
The good news is that lint-related problems are often preventable through routine maintenance and professional cleaning when needed. Removing accumulated lint helps restore airflow while supporting more efficient dryer operation.

Improper Vent Installation Can Reduce Efficiency
Not all dryer vent problems develop after installation. In some cases, performance issues begin because the vent system was not installed in an optimal manner.
Several installation-related concerns may affect dryer efficiency:
- Excessively long vent runs
- Sharp bends in ductwork
- Improper vent materials
- Poor vent routing
- Loose connections
- Inadequate exterior vent placement
- Restricted airflow design
When vent systems contain unnecessary obstacles, airflow may be reduced even if no lint buildup is present. Over time, these restrictions can contribute to longer drying times and reduced performance.
Many homeowners assume all vent systems function similarly, but installation quality plays a significant role in overall airflow efficiency. Proper vent design helps ensure moisture, heat, and lint move through the system effectively.
If recurring performance issues continue despite regular maintenance, installation-related factors may deserve closer evaluation.

Damaged Vent Components Should Never Be Ignored
Dryer vent systems may experience wear and damage over time. Physical damage can occur due to aging materials, remodeling projects, accidental impacts, or environmental conditions.
Damaged vent components may include:
- Crushed duct sections
- Loose vent connections
- Torn vent materials
- Detached vent joints
- Exterior vent damage
- Corroded components
- Improperly sealed sections
Even minor damage can affect airflow and create restrictions that reduce dryer efficiency. Because much of the vent system remains hidden behind walls or within utility areas, homeowners may not immediately recognize that damage exists.
As airflow becomes compromised, dryers often compensate by running longer cycles. While the appliance may continue functioning, efficiency gradually declines, and performance issues become more noticeable.
Addressing damaged vent components promptly helps restore airflow while preventing minor issues from becoming larger concerns.

Simple Habits That Help Tampa Homeowners Maintain Dryer Efficiency
Preventing dryer vent performance issues does not always require major changes. Many common concerns can be reduced through simple maintenance habits performed consistently throughout the year.
Helpful preventative practices include:
- Cleaning the lint screen after every load
- Monitoring drying cycle performance
- Inspecting exterior vent openings
- Watching for airflow changes
- Scheduling routine maintenance
- Addressing unusual dryer behavior
- Keeping laundry areas clean
These habits help homeowners recognize developing concerns before they significantly affect dryer efficiency. Small performance changes often provide valuable clues about vent system health. Paying attention to drying times, airflow, and overall dryer operation allows homeowners to respond quickly when issues begin developing.
